The Lowrance Elite-4 CHIRP fishfinder is compatible with a variety of transducers, including CHIRP and traditional sonar transducers. The transducer you choose will depend on the type of fishing you plan to do, as well as the depth and water conditions of your fishing area.

Here are some compatible transducers that you can use with your Lowrance Elite-4 CHIRP fishfinder:

  1. Lowrance HDI Skimmer Transducer: This is a dual-frequency transducer that combines both CHIRP and traditional sonar technologies. It is ideal for freshwater and shallow saltwater fishing.
  2. Lowrance HDI Transom Mount Transducer: This is a high-frequency CHIRP transducer that is designed for use in deeper saltwater environments.
  3. Lowrance P66 Transom Mount Transducer: This is a traditional sonar transducer that operates at high frequencies and is suitable for both freshwater and saltwater fishing.
  4. Airmar P79 In-Hull Transducer: This is a high-frequency CHIRP transducer that is mounted inside the hull of your boat. It is ideal for use in shallow water and is suitable for both freshwater and saltwater fishing.

When selecting a transducer for your Lowrance Elite-4 CHIRP fishfinder, make sure to choose one that is compatible with the frequency range of your fishfinder and that is appropriate for the type of fishing you plan to do.

... in this section are for information on the transducer. This unit supports High CHIRP, Medium CHIRP and Low CHIRP, depending on Downscan features. CHIRP can be used with Lowrance conventional sonar transducers. • 50/200 kHz (Low/High CHIRP) • 83/200 kHz (Medium/High CHIRP) To use CHIRP, select the desired CHIRP frequency from the Frequency menu.
